Inch-long southern cricket frog

At 0.75–1.5 inches (16–32 mm) in length, Acris gryllus is even smaller than A. crepitans. Other characters that differentiate the southern species are: • More pointed snout--A. crepitans more blunt. • Hind leg is more than half length of the body when folded—that of A. crepitans is less than one half body length. When rear leg is extended forward, the heel of A. gryllus usually reaches beyond the snout—does not reach snout in A. crepitans. Webback, and is similar in size to the peeper . WebLength 15-33 mm The southern cricket frog or southeastern cricket frog ( Acris gryllus ) is a small hylid frog native to the Southeastern United States. It is very similar in appearance and habits to the northern cricket frog, Acris crepitans, and was considered formerly conspecific (Dickerson 1906). WebIt’s only five-eighths to 1 3/8 inches long. Its range extends from extreme southern New York to the Florida panhandle, and west to the outskirts of Texas. Unlike most tree frogs, the cricket frog has warty, rough skin similar to a toad. Its body is gray with a black stripe on each side. It also has a dark triangular shape on its head.
